IC 31-33-3-4 Meetings; agenda

     Sec. 4. (a) The community child protection team shall meet:

(1) at least one (1) time each month; or

(2) at the times that the team's services are needed by the department.

     (b) Meetings of the team shall be called by the majority vote of the members of the team.

     (c) The team coordinator or at least two (2) other members of the team may determine the agenda.

     (d) Notwithstanding IC 5-14-1.5, meetings of the team are open only to persons authorized to receive information under this article.

[Pre-1997 Recodification Citation: 31-6-11-15(c), (d), (e), (f).]

As added by P.L.1-1997, SEC.16. Amended by P.L.234-2005, SEC.103.
